In 1791, President Washington commissioned Pierre Charles L'Enfant, a French-born architect and metropolis planner, to design the model new capital. He enlisted Scottish surveyor Alexander Ralston to assist lay out town plan. The L'Enfant Plan featured broad streets and avenues radiating out from rectangles, offering room for open house and landscaping. He based his design on plans of cities such as Paris, Amsterdam, Karlsruhe, and Milan that Thomas Jefferson had despatched to him. L'Enfant's design also envisioned a garden-lined "grand avenue" approximately 1 mile (1.6 km) in length and 400 toes wide within the space that is now the National Mall.

On August 24–25, 1814, in a raid known as the Burning of Washington, British forces invaded the capital through the War of 1812. The Capitol, Treasury, and White House have been burned and gutted in the course of the assault. Most government buildings had been repaired shortly; nevertheless, the Capitol was largely beneath building on the time and was not completed in its present type till 1868.

The federal Height of Buildings Act of 1910 allows buildings which would possibly be no taller than the width of the adjacent street, plus 20 toes (6.1 m). Despite popular perception, no law has ever limited buildings to the height of the United States Capitol Building or the 555-foot Washington Monument, which remains the district's tallest structure. City leaders have criticized the peak restriction as a primary purpose why the district has limited inexpensive housing and site visitors problems caused by suburban sprawl.
